Transaction 70caf636c03c80d452926769fa938686766c60f5ef513d506e53b233bafe3983
1 Input
1 Output
-
70caf636c03c80d452926769fa938686766c60f5ef513d506e53b233bafe3983:0
- value
- 299960000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 69f1fb6816753158cdc188958df232166e181feb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AfBqMKJsQwb6NyPmwR9m9yLZKcSdM7WSq